Output 3ec743313944d815233332c3c108758d790056654c18402d203d351d736e0eee:6

value
249034
script pubkey
OP_0 OP_PUSHBYTES_20 c278d64dc731f158f2a08112904551e567b028af
address
bc1qcfudvnw8x8c43u4qsyffq323u4nmq290ef6l9a
transaction
3ec743313944d815233332c3c108758d790056654c18402d203d351d736e0eee